Renault: We need to resolve issues that could compromise our season
Renault F1 Team previews the fourth race weekend of the 2019 FIA Formula 1 World Championship, the SOCAR Azerbaijan Grand Prix. Drivers Nico Hülkenberg and Daniel Ricciardo share their thoughts on the challenges of the Baku City Circuit, while Cyril Abiteboul and Chassis Technical Director Nick Chester give the latest on the team and on the 2019 package. Cyril Abiteboul, Team Principal: 'If our objective this season – to widen the midfield gap – remains unchanged then we must accept to put in strong efforts to resolve these issues that could compromise our season.'
